      It should come as no surprise that October is my favorite month of the year. Although the season of fall starts in late September, it never really goes into full speed until October. Since fall is my favorite season, it only makes sense that October and fall go hand in hand. As this month comes to an end, allow me to reflect on what I love most about fall. 

      Pumpkin–This love affair of mine comes in many shapes and sizes. I love pumpkins to carve..

      I love pumpkins to hunt for/decoration..

      Little did this guy know that he would be that nights dinner.

      Annnd I love pumpkins to eat..

      I roasted this with brown sugar and cinnamon. YUM!

      Homemade pumpkin muffins, equipped with pumpkin seeds!

      Self explanatory.

      Pumpkin pancakes.

      Along with pumpkins come any kind of squash or gourd too. 

      Brussels Sprouts–Although these round miniature balls are available all year round, the peak growing season is September-February. 


      That Brussels stalk/sword allowed me to fight off the raccoon’s that tried to steal my ice cream.

      Honeycrisp Apples–These gargantuan apples come around this time of year, and boy am I glad they do. I tried my first apple on steroids the other day. I baked them with brown sugar and cinnamon, paired with none other than pumpkin ice cream. 

      Soup–When the weather gets cold, soup is my go to. I wish I could swim in a giant vat of soup and use broccoli as a flotation device. 

      Weather–The cool air, with the sunny skies, along with scattered, multicolored leaves are my ALL TIME favorite days of the year. HANDS down. Plus bundling up with jackets, boots, and scarves is amazing. Boots allow you to sneak candy into any building.

      Halloween– I am slightly upset that I was unable to go trick or treating this year due to my best friends work schedule, but I was able to stay home and hand out candy.

      Trust me guys, my house is THE house to come to. I HOOKED these kids up…at least three pieces EACH child. You can thank me for your saddlebags and sugar induced comas later. 

      After October comes November, and who doesn’t like November. Thanksgiving is the one day of the year where you are EXPECTED to stuff your face until you are forced to breathe out of any orifice other than your mouth. Goodbye October..you were good to me. Thank you for starting the best fall trends.
